Abstract EN
Postmating, prezygotic phenotypes are a common mechanism of reproductive isolation.
Here, we describe the dynamics of a noncompetitive gametic isolation phenotype (namely, the ability of a male to induce a female to lay eggs) in a group of recently diverged crickets that are primarily isolated from each other by this phenotype.
We not only show that heterospecific males are less able to induce females to lay eggs but that there are male by female incompatibilities in this phenotype that occur within populations.
We also identify a protein in the female reproductive tract that correlates with the number of eggs that she was induced to lay.
Functional genetic tests using RNAi confirm that the function of this protein is linked to egg-laying induction.
Moreover, the dysfunction of this protein appears to underlie both within-population incompatibilities and between-species divergence—thus suggesting a common genetic pathway underlies both.
However, this is only correlative evidence and further research is needed to assess whether or not the same mutations in the same genes underlie variation at both levels.
